Analysis
Reunion recorded 6,581 1000 USD for paper and paperboard — import value in 2024.
That represents a change of unchanged over ten years.
Over the whole period, paper and paperboard — import value in Reunion peaked at 26,319 1000 USD in 1992 and was at its lowest, 236 1000 USD, in 1965.
Reunion ranks 177th of 255 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
